Hi folks — front desk here at Merridew Court. The support team from Calverix are doing night work on the comms risers this week, roughly 22:00–05:00. Overnight the main doors are locked and our night porter does rounds, so don't be startled if he appears. Sign in at the lobby book each night, even if you signed in the day before. To get through the lobby inner door after hours, use the pass code below.

staff pass of kawip-hawef = bdg-QLP-2

Subject: Support Outsourcing Plan — Status

Team,

Ahead of Director Halveny's arrival, a summary of the Tier-1 support outsourcing plan. We shortlisted two providers, both with centres in Port Ansel. Cost modelling shows 22% savings at steady state. Transition would run eight months, with knowledge transfer first. Staff consultation begins next month. The strategic reasoning behind the timing is set out in the note that follows.

confidential, kagep-kahof: Druokax Systems plans to lower the Ulaath list price by 53 percent in March.

## Webhook Retry Semantics — Provenance Builds

Quick note for release: Forgewell retries webhook delivery three times with exponential backoff, then parks the event in the dead-letter bin. Provenance attestations are only stamped after the *final* successful delivery, so don't panic if the badge lags a minute. Each retry chain gets tagged so you can trace it end to end. The token for the chain appears below.

pipeline stamp: htk31_f769b577b3028a4e9958e5bb8d1259a